    Whoever told you, you can perform a controlled jackknife is full of crap. The only controlled jackknife is when you jackknife the truck into a dock or parking spot.





    A jackknifing tractor/trailer is about the most out of control situation you can ever be in, in a truck. There is absolutely NOTHING you can do to control or correct the situation. You will have drivers tell you that you can gas on it or use the trolley valve to pull it out of a jackknife, but I can guarantee you, they have never been in the situation and they don't know what they are talking about. When a tractor trailer starts jackknifing, from the time it starts, to the time it's all over with is split seconds. It isn't enough time for you to comprehend what is happening and react to it. Even if there was anything you could do, there is no time to do it.
    No because they are thought to not get into that situation, however being in that situation before, it's all about perception %26amp; what is called brake lag. Perception is the time for the mind to see a problem %26amp; tell the leg to step on the brakes. Brake lag is the time for the leg to apply the brakes till the brakes actually engage.     Are all CLASS D AIRPORTS FAA controlled?

    i know that there are control towers that are not FAA-operated. what types of airports have those?Are all CLASS D AIRPORTS FAA controlled?
    SGR in Sugarland Texas has a non-FAA tower, of that I am certain because I know one of the controllers. So the question is whether that non-FAA tower is surrounded by Class D Airspace. A Quick examination of FAA Order 7400.9t says about SGR





    ASW TX D Houston Sugar Land Municipal/Hull Field, TX


    Sugar Land, Sugar Land Municipal/Hull Field, TX


    (lat. 29飩?7'20';N., long. 95飩?9'24';W.)


    That airspace extending upward from the surface to and including 2,600 feet MSL within a


    4.2-mile radius of Sugar Land Municipal/Hull Field. This Class D airspace area is effective


    during the specific dates and times established in advance by a Notice to Airmen. The effective


    date and time will thereafter be continuously published in the Airport/Facility Directory.








    So the answer is no. SGR is controlled by a fairly large corporation, not the FAA, that provides controller services to smaller airports, and it, in fact, has Class D airspace.Are all CLASS D AIRPORTS FAA controlled?
    Not entirely. There are now 250 or so Class D airports (with operating VFR (non-radar) control towers, to clarify some of the previous answerers) that are run by third-party contractors that are essentially outsourced by the Federal government as part of an impetus to move towards privatization of the National Airspace System. We'll likely see more of this in the not too distant future, and it's not necessarily all a good thing.
    They will be identified on a sectional chart by NFCT - Non Federal Control Tower.

    Something I try when they are out of control is i say in a low voice directions. For example, I will say


    ';If you can hear me, wiggle your fingers';


    ';If you can hear me, snap your fingers';


    ';If you can hear me, put your hands up high';...etc


    The reason I do this is first of all, you don't have to scream. Second of all you see who is actually paying attention to what you are saying. You will be surprised that some students in the back of the room are actually doing what you are saying because they pay attention. Another reason why this works is because those that are not listening will see students around them all of a sudden do these movements and they don't know why so they begin to pay attention to what you are saying. Some think its just like a game but you are doing it to get their attention without having to yell over them. After about 4 directions you should have most of the class following. If not, you can always single out the ones that aren't, by then the class should be quiet enough. After you have everyone doing it, let them know that they were not doing as they were supposed to. Depending on how out of control, after everyone is quiet I tell them to put their heads down ( for like half a minute) then continue with the lesson/activity.


    If it continues I just tell them they will have to lose out on recess for every time I have to stop again.
    I don't know exactly what age group you're working with, but there is a teacher i used to work with who had a great technique that worked well for students from K to 5th grade. She would do a sort of rhythmic clapping that she instructed the students early on to repeat. Everytime the students would get out of control she would just start to clap loudly. The pattern didn't really matter. The children would immediately quiet down and repeat the pattern. She would always do this three times with different patterns, and the 4th time she would always end with 3 quick claps which meant it was over. I was amazed by how well this worked and put the students' attention in your hands. Give it a try.

    You might have deeper problems than just stuttering. How you describe ';freezing up'; seems to suggest that you might have a form of anxiety, almost like stage fright, when it comes to being put on the spot in a large group. It might force your stutter to resurface, and/or just the anxiety of thinking about stuttering in front of everyone probably makes it worse. If you can answer without a stutter when you control your breathing and you're calm, maybe something is getting in the way of utilizing those techniques when you're in class.





    I'd try seeing a psychologist or psychiatrist. Anxiety is extremely common in people with speech impediments, and only worsens them. Since you can speak fine at home, and it's only in class that you have problems, there's something more at play than the stutter itself. They can teach you coping mechanisms to increase your level of calm even on the spot, or prescribe things like Prosaic or Zoloft that help diminish the effects of anxiety.





    Plus, if you're officially diagnosed with anxiety or someone evaluates your stutter, you can request that your teachers be given notice about your needs in class, so that participation points don't count against you or that accommodations are made. It's simply not fair that someone would have to try so harder than everyone else to participate, because it's so much more difficult and stressful for them than it is for others. Thus, schools are typically required by law to make accommodations so that you can get the good grades you deserve without being asked to do anything that you shouldn't be asked to do.

    ActiveX controls are mini programs some web sites can use to run video's or multimedia stuff on their sites.





    If you have Windows XP Service Pack 2 (SP2) internet explorer 6 sp 1 will prompt you (have the little yellow bar at the top of the window) to allow it. This is done because when Netscape first introduced scripting to web sites it was used for cool audio and video applications. Then Microsoft tried to stay in the race with Netscape created their own scripting and called it ActiveX.





    But like all things that were done for the right reasons hackers and spamers and virus makers saw a use for these applications and started putting malicious ones on sites and infecting computers.





    So Microsoft felt the pressure from security organizations and from consumers to help block these bad activeX's from running, so now when ever there is one on a site internet explorer for Service Pack 2 will ask you if you want to install the mini program.





    Now that the history lesson is over, I will try to answer your question, if this is a web site that you trust 100% you can right click (click with the right mouse button) and selcect install activeX control and it will be installed for 99% of future uses of the site, unless they change the mini program.





    I would suggest that you not install any ActiveX or java controls on any web sites you do not trust 100% because there are a lot of sites out there that are really poorly managed and you can get infected.
